I went to the OGCA show over the weekend and while not really looking for anything in particular I came across a nice old post 64 Winchester M-70 with a Redfield 4x scope (1977 to be exact). The market has long been soft on bolt action hunting rifles and this was a slow show. Not only was the asking price low the seller was motivated to sell, so I threw out a stupid low-ball offer and was surprised when it was accepted. So for a mere 300 bones I have another .30-06.

I whipped up a standard starting load of a 168 grain Hornady A-Max over 47.9 grains of IMR 4895 and took it to the range last night. The rifle shot a nice group at 100 yards with just a 4x scope.
